Thick toxic fumes, and flames rising up from the latest Ukrainian drone attack on the Rosneft-owned Tuapse oil refinery, almost reached the heights of the surrounding Caucasus mountains.

By Thursday morning, authorities said the fire had been extinguished. Fires from the two previous attacks, on April 16 and 20, also took days to put out, with toxic substances pouring down in black rain and blanketing cars and streets in oily grime, leading to what experts are dubbing the worst environmental disaster in the region in years.

As early as 1818, the Moscow military was massacring Circassian villagers. Commander‑in‑Chief Alexei Ermolov led some of the first mass violence against them that year, after Circassian tribesmen refused to help the Moscow forces capture members of other tribes accused of raiding Moscow territory. Ermolov had the tribe’s aul surrounded, flushed out the inhabitants, stole their livestock, and burned what remained. Compared to what came later, it was merciful.

Military activity continued into the 1820s, helped by the plague that hit the Circassians in those years. Hundreds of auls were destroyed by Moscow raids, and the entire Kabardia region of the Northern Caucasus mountains was cleared of Circassians by 1830. Most had fled into Western Circassia, which was far beyond 🇷🇺 Moscow colonial control.

Preparations for Genocide

Technically, though, Moscow empire did not control any part of Circassia and had no legitimate claim to it. They made sure to change that in 1829. The Treaty of Adrianople, signed to end hostilities with the Ottomans, recognised Moscow’s colonial claim to the entire Black Sea coast. It didn’t directly name Circassia, but Tsar Nicholas I acted as if it did.
